1. Implementing spectrum commons: Implications for Thailand
Sammanfattning : Spectrum is a natural and limited resource that needs to be managed both internationally and nationally because of the unique propagation characteristics of radio waves. Once transmitted, a radio signal propagates until its power is depleted. Furthermore, electromagnetic energy does not recognize borders between countries. LÄS MER

3. Spectrum Assignment Policy: Towards an Evaluation of Spectrum Commons in Thailand
Sammanfattning : There is consensus among economists, engineers, and lawyers that a traditional command-and-control approach to spectrum assignment is inefficient and that a market-based or commons approach can be more efficient. The purpose of this thesis is to find the benefits of using spectrum commons for frequency assignment in Thailand. LÄS MER
